Output e34cc542f69085c2c3470d0eeb584c5b939c41bef3014070da04efc876c0cdb5:32

value
1526573
script pubkey
OP_0 OP_PUSHBYTES_20 19d67f2b72b060af309e74d7a950abc91a6f8219
address
bc1qr8t872mjkps27vy7wnt6j59teydxlqsefscj8e
transaction
e34cc542f69085c2c3470d0eeb584c5b939c41bef3014070da04efc876c0cdb5
spent
true